Occupational disability and claims management

WCB costs can escalate quickly. All costs, including wages and medical expenses paid by WCB, come back to the employer. Additionally, claim costs remain on the customer experience report for 3 years, driving up insurance premiums even if no further injuries occur. Features

Initial Assessment
A thorough evaluation of the employee’s medical information, understanding the job demands, and analytical assessment of the supported absence and recovery options.
Ongoing case management support
As the case evolves, developing a tailored plan to address the specific needs of the disabled employee, including monitoring and optimizing medical treatment, rehabilitation opportunities, and workplace accommodations.
Communication with Healthcare Providers
Ensuring seamless communication between the employee, healthcare providers, and the employer to facilitate effective treatment and accommodation opportunities as they are identified.
Accommodation and Return-to-Work Planning
Creating a structured plan to help the employee transition back to work, including gradual reintegration and outlining any temporary or permanent job modifications.
Ongoing Monitoring and Support
Regular follow-ups to track the employee’s progress, adjust case management plan as needed, and provide continuous support through the course of the absence.
Meticulous Documentation
Maintaining accurate records and ensuring status updates are provided to the employer, insurer and employee to maintain clear lines of communication throughout the process.
